The Samsung Galaxy S23 Plus, released in February 2023, and the iPhone 14 Plus, launched in October 2022, are both large-screen smartphones designed for users seeking an expansive viewing experience. While the Galaxy S23 Plus operates on the Android ecosystem with Samsung's One UI, the iPhone 14 Plus runs on Apple's iOS. These devices offer distinct approaches to performance, camera capabilities, and user interface, catering to different preferences.

Durability

When considering the long-term usability of these devices, several factors contribute to their expected practical lifespan, including software support and physical resilience.

  • Release Timeline and Software Support: The Galaxy S23 Plus, being released in early 2023, benefits from a slightly newer launch date compared to the iPhone 14 Plus, which debuted in late 2022. Typically, Android devices receive several years of major operating system updates and security patches, while Apple is known for providing extended software support, often exceeding five years for its iPhones. This means the iPhone 14 Plus may receive iOS updates for approximately 5-6 years from its release, potentially offering a longer period of official software longevity.
  • Physical Durability: Both smartphones feature robust construction. The iPhone 14 Plus incorporates a Ceramic Shield front cover and an aluminum design, contributing to its durability and drop protection. The Galaxy S23 Plus is protected by Corning Gorilla Glass Victus 2 on both the front and back, along with an Armor Aluminum frame, enhancing its resistance to scratches and impacts. Both devices also carry an IP68 rating for dust and water resistance, indicating they can withstand submersion in up to 6 meters of water for 30 minutes.
  • Repairability: While specific repairability scores can vary, both manufacturers design their devices with certain repair considerations. Users seeking to extend the life of their device through repairs might find varying availability and cost of parts and services depending on the ecosystem.

Performance

The performance of a smartphone is crucial for daily tasks, from navigating applications to engaging in demanding activities like gaming and video editing. Both the Galaxy S23 Plus and the iPhone 14 Plus deliver responsive experiences, though they achieve this through different hardware and software optimizations.

  • Processing Power: The Galaxy S23 Plus is equipped with a current-generation processor specifically optimized for Samsung devices, which contributes to efficient performance and faster application launches. The iPhone 14 Plus utilizes a powerful chip from the previous year's Pro models, featuring a 6-core CPU and a 5-core GPU. Both processors are capable of handling demanding applications and multitasking smoothly.
  • Multitasking and Responsiveness: The Galaxy S23 Plus typically comes with 8GB of RAM, which supports fluid multitasking and app management. The iPhone 14 Plus features 6GB of RAM. In real-world usage, both devices offer a highly responsive user experience, with quick app loading times and smooth transitions.
  • Storage Options: The Galaxy S23 Plus starts with 256GB of internal storage, with a 512GB option also available. The iPhone 14 Plus offers more varied storage configurations, starting at 128GB and extending to 256GB and 512GB. Users with extensive media libraries or numerous applications may find the higher base storage of the Galaxy S23 Plus beneficial.
  • Battery Behavior: The Galaxy S23 Plus houses a 4700 mAh battery, while the iPhone 14 Plus has a 4325 mAh battery. In practical use, the iPhone 14 Plus is noted for its efficient battery management, often providing extended usage times. The Galaxy S23 Plus also offers strong battery performance, with users reporting it can last through a full day of heavy use.

Screen quality

The display is a primary interface for smartphone interaction, and both the Galaxy S23 Plus and iPhone 14 Plus offer large, high-quality screens that enhance the viewing experience.

  • Display Technology and Size: The Galaxy S23 Plus features a 6.6-inch Dynamic AMOLED 2X display, known for its vibrant colors, deep blacks, and excellent contrast. The iPhone 14 Plus comes with a slightly larger 6.7-inch Super Retina XDR OLED display, which also delivers rich colors and high contrast.
  • Resolution and Clarity: The iPhone 14 Plus has a resolution of 2778 x 1284 pixels, resulting in a pixel density of approximately 458 pixels per inch (ppi). The Galaxy S23 Plus offers a resolution of 2340 x 1080 pixels, with a pixel density of around 393 ppi. While the iPhone 14 Plus technically has a sharper display, the difference in clarity may be subtle to the naked eye for most users.
  • Brightness and Refresh Rate: The Galaxy S23 Plus boasts a peak brightness of 1750 nits, making it highly visible even in bright outdoor conditions. The iPhone 14 Plus reaches a peak brightness of 1200 nits for HDR content and 800 nits typical. A significant difference lies in the refresh rate: the Galaxy S23 Plus features an adaptive 120Hz refresh rate for smoother scrolling and animations, while the iPhone 14 Plus maintains a standard 60Hz refresh rate.

Audiovisual

Both devices offer advanced camera systems capable of capturing high-quality photos and videos, though they approach imaging with different hardware configurations and software processing.

  • Rear Camera Systems: The Galaxy S23 Plus features a versatile triple-camera setup on the rear, including a 50MP wide-angle lens with optical image stabilization (OIS), a 10MP telephoto lens with 3x optical zoom, and a 12MP ultrawide lens. This telephoto lens provides an advantage for zoomed-in shots. The iPhone 14 Plus comes with a dual-camera system, comprising a 12MP main wide-angle lens with OIS and a 12MP ultrawide lens.
  • Photography Performance: The Galaxy S23 Plus is noted for producing sharp and bright images, particularly in low-light conditions with its Nightography features. The iPhone 14 Plus, with its Photonic Engine, also excels in low-light performance, delivering improved detail and color. User preferences often come down to color science, with the iPhone tending towards warmer, more natural tones and the Galaxy offering slightly colder, more vibrant shades.
  • Video Recording and Front Camera: Both phones support high-quality video recording. The Galaxy S23 Plus can record video at up to 8K resolution, while the iPhone 14 Plus offers 4K Dolby Vision HDR video recording and features like Cinematic mode and Action mode for enhanced stabilization. Both devices are equipped with 12MP front-facing cameras, with the iPhone 14 Plus's TrueDepth camera featuring autofocus and improved low-light capabilities.

Miscellaneous

Beyond core performance and display, several practical features and design elements differentiate these two large-screen smartphones.

  • Connectivity: Both devices support 5G connectivity for fast mobile data speeds. They also feature modern Wi-Fi standards and Bluetooth for wireless connections.
  • Ports and Biometrics: The Galaxy S23 Plus utilizes a USB-C port for charging and data transfer, and it incorporates an under-display fingerprint scanner for biometric authentication. The iPhone 14 Plus uses Apple's Lightning port and relies on Face ID for secure facial recognition.
  • Design and Handling: The Galaxy S23 Plus measures 157.8 x 76.2 x 7.6 mm and weighs 196g. The iPhone 14 Plus is slightly larger and heavier at 160.8 x 78.1 x 7.8 mm and 203g. Both phones feature flat screens and a premium feel, though the iPhone 14 Plus retains a notch at the top of its display, while the Galaxy S23 Plus has a punch-hole cutout for its front camera.
  • Unique Features: The Galaxy S23 Plus offers features like Samsung DeX for a desktop-like experience and enhanced split-screen multitasking. The iPhone 14 Plus includes safety features such as Crash Detection and Emergency SOS via satellite, which can be crucial in emergency situations.

The Samsung Galaxy S23 Plus and the iPhone 14 Plus each present a compelling package for users seeking a large-screen smartphone, with distinct strengths that cater to different priorities. Users often praise the Galaxy S23 Plus for its vibrant 120Hz display, versatile triple camera system with optical zoom, and the flexibility offered by the Android operating system, including features like Samsung DeX and advanced multitasking. Its strong battery life and faster charging capabilities are also frequently highlighted as positive aspects.

On the other hand, the iPhone 14 Plus is often lauded for its consistent camera performance, robust software support longevity, and the seamless integration within the Apple ecosystem. Its safety features, such as Crash Detection and Emergency SOS via satellite, are also significant advantages for some users. Some common criticisms of the iPhone 14 Plus include its 60Hz display refresh rate, which is lower than many Android counterparts, and the absence of a dedicated telephoto lens.

Users prioritizing a highly customizable experience, a high refresh rate display, and a telephoto camera may find the Galaxy S23 Plus well-suited to their needs. Conversely, users who value extended software support, a consistent and intuitive operating system, and advanced safety features may lean towards the iPhone 14 Plus. Both devices represent quality options, and choosing between them often comes down to individual preferences within their respective ecosystems.
